Most saved kitchens contain several different ideas: a colour, an island proportion, a warm material, an opening detail, or an uncluttered composition. Design is the work of understanding why those details matter, testing them against the room, and making one coherent answer.
We separate the useful signals—proportion, warmth, contrast, storage, openness, detail—from the parts that do not fit the home.
Light, ceiling height, windows, circulation, appliances, cooking, cleanup, gathering, and connected rooms shape the plan.
Drawings and material decisions bring the layout, elevations, cabinet interiors, surfaces, openings, and light into one buildable direction.
